Why These Are the Top Pest Control Contractors in Junction

** The pest control market serving Junction, Utah, is characterized by a reliance on regional providers based in the larger, neighboring city of Richfield. Due to the rural and mountainous nature of Piute County, common pest issues include rodents (mice and voles), ants, spiders, and occasional wildlife intrusions. The competition level is moderate, with a few key players dominating the local market. Service quality is generally high, as these companies have built their reputation on serving rural communities across central Utah. Typical pricing for a standard quarterly pest control service for an average-sized home can range from **$100 to $150 per treatment**, with initial one-time services (e.g., rodent removal) often costing between **$250 and $450**. Most reputable companies offer free inspections and eco-friendly options upon request. Customers in this area highly value reliability, local knowledge, and prompt service due to the distances involved.

Frequently Asked Questions About Pest Control in Junction

Get answers to common questions about pest control services in Junction, Utah.

1What are the most common pests I need to protect my Junction home from, and when are they most active?

Due to Junction's semi-arid climate and proximity to agricultural land and the Sevier River, common pests include rodents (mice, voles), spiders (including black widows), ants (especially pavement ants), and occasional scorpions. Rodent activity increases in fall as they seek warmth, while spiders and ants are most problematic from late spring through early fall. Seasonal moisture from the Sevier River can also drive pests toward drier structures.

2How much should I expect to pay for regular pest control service in Junction?

For a standard quarterly exterior treatment for a typical single-family home in Junction, expect to pay between $45 and $75 per service visit. Initial one-time treatments for active infestations are typically higher, ranging from $125 to $300, depending on the pest and home size. Pricing is generally in line with rural Utah markets but can be influenced by the travel distance for providers based in larger towns.

3Are there any local Utah or Piute County regulations I should be aware of when hiring a pest control company?

Yes. Any company applying pesticides must be licensed by the Utah Department of Agriculture and Food (UDAF). You should always verify their UDAF license number. Additionally, due to Utah's sensitive desert ecosystem and Junction's location, reputable companies will follow strict guidelines for pesticide use near water sources like the Sevier River to protect water quality.

4Is "green" or organic pest control effective and available in Junction, UT?

Yes, many providers offer integrated pest management (IPM) strategies that prioritize prevention and use targeted, reduced-risk products. These methods are effective for long-term control and are well-suited to Junction's environment, helping to protect family pets, livestock, and gardens. However, availability may be limited to larger regional companies that service the area, so it's important to inquire specifically about these options.
